The Importance Of Monitoring Core Temperature With A Core Temperature Monitor

Monitoring core temperature is crucial for various activities and professions, such as athletes, firefighters, military personnel, and individuals working in extreme environments. By keeping track of core body temperature, individuals can prevent heat-related illnesses, optimize performance, and ensure safety. One of the key tools used for monitoring core temperature is a core temperature monitor.

A core temperature monitor is a device that accurately measures the internal temperature of the body. Unlike external temperature monitoring devices like infrared thermometers or forehead strips, a core temperature monitor provides a more precise reading by measuring the temperature internally. This is usually done through invasive methods like rectal, esophageal, or tympanic temperature measurements.

One of the main benefits of using a core temperature monitor is its accuracy. In situations where slight variations in body temperature can make a significant difference in performance or health, having a precise measurement is essential. For example, athletes competing in endurance sports like marathons or triathlons rely on accurate core temperature monitoring to avoid heat exhaustion or dehydration.

Firefighters and military personnel also benefit greatly from using core temperature monitors. These individuals often work in high-stress environments where their bodies are subjected to intense physical exertion and extreme temperatures. By monitoring their core temperature, firefighters and military personnel can prevent heat stroke, heat exhaustion, and other heat-related illnesses that can be life-threatening.

Another advantage of using a core temperature monitor is the ability to track temperature changes over time. By continuously monitoring core body temperature during exercise or work, individuals can identify trends and patterns that may indicate an impending heat-related illness. This early detection can prompt individuals to take necessary precautions, such as hydrating more frequently, taking breaks, or cooling down.

Furthermore, core temperature monitoring can help optimize performance in various settings. Athletes, for example, can use core temperature data to fine-tune their training regimen and improve endurance. By monitoring how their body responds to different temperatures and levels of exertion, athletes can adjust their training intensity to achieve peak performance.

In the medical field, core temperature monitoring is also essential for diagnosing and treating various conditions. Patients in critical care units, for instance, may have their core temperature monitored continuously to detect fever or hypothermia. By closely monitoring core temperature, healthcare providers can intervene promptly and prevent adverse outcomes.
